Hixar Fermi (ヒクサー・フェルミ Hikusā Ferumi?) is a fictional character in the side stories of Mobile Suit Gundam 00. In Mobile Suit Gundam 00P, Hixar is the Krung Thep's pilot to the GNR-000 GN Sefer and an assistant to Grave Violento. After his disappearance at the end of 00P, he returns in Mobile Suit Gundam 00F as an Innovade agent from Veda to follow the actions of Fon Spaak and the organization, Fereshte, after the defeat of Celestial Being; he pilots the GNY-002F Gundam Sadalsuud Type F. Hixar also appears in Mobile Suit Gundam 00I and pilots the GN-XXX + GNR-000 Sefer Rasiel.

Personality & Character

In the second season of 00P, Hixar Fermi is known for his light hearted personality and jester like behavior. When he isn't backing up Grave in the GN Sefer he is spending time with the other members of Krung Thep joking around. After Hixar has a mental breakdown as a result of Grave's death he becomes more serious as he strives to reconstruct himself. 

Skills & Capabilities

Through piloting the support unit GN Sefer, Hixar proves that he is a capable pilot. Although his role in battle is small in 00P he further improves his skills over the years. By 00F Hixar is able to pilot the Sadalsuud F on par with Fon Spaak and can operate the Sadalsuud's precise particle manipulation to create small GN fields. Although it is unclear whether this is a result of Hixar's increased skill or an ability that he possesses as an Innovade.

History

New protagonist in new chapter of Mobile Suit Gundam 00P. Pilot of GN Sefer. His jovial personality allows him to talk freely with almost anyone, even when meeting them for the first time. Hixar enjoys making others laugh, though has considerable trouble doing so with the serious Grave and dark-mannered Chall. Several years later, he appears in 00F as a Gundam Meister on orders from Veda to follow Fon Spaak, who has been working independently from Fereshte. While Hixar appears to be the same man from 00P, his personality is markedly different and he is shown to have a remotely-detonatable explosive strapped around his neck.
